- Summary:
- Examines development and provisions of P.L. 88-352, the Civil Rights Act of 1964, which provides for extensive civil rights measures. Reviews legislative background, from Jan.-May 1963, and traces legislative history of Act from Kennedy Administration proposal, to passage through the House and the Senate. Outlines pro/con arguments for bill, and presents full text of final Act.
